I originally bought my frogs as a proxy dwarf warband for a Mordheim campaign, they now get used for games of Tribal (Mana Press' Samurai supplement - Zanshin is due out shortly).
Rule-wise I don't think there's anything out there like Ganesha Games' 'Song of Fur and Buttons' (
http://www.ganeshagames.net/product_info.php?cPath=1_6&products_id=13
) that were written for Eureka Miniatures' teddy bears, but on TMP (
http://theminiaturespage.com/boards/msg.mv?id=305698
) there's a few recommendations. One of them is for Ganesha Games' Song of the splintered Lands (
http://www.ganeshagames.net/product_info.php?cPath=1_6&products_id=65
). I'm not sure that can accommodate frogs and turtles though.
Go with whatever you want - they slot well into any rule set really well (e.g. frogs as dwarves, rabbits as elves, turtles as orcs and terrapins as goblins).
